 Inviting applications for the role of Business Analyst, Aftermarket services

In this role, you Customer Support in After Sales topics and managing customer requests claims.

Responsibilities

Processing of customer enquiries · Calculation creation of repair service quotes including technical description.

Monitoring of the cases (technical, administrative, delivery times customer contact)

Analysis of customer needs and subsequent implementation of individual concepts

Support in After Market / After Sales strategies processes

Project lead of selected cases in the section of technical support, claims and customer satisfaction

Internal and external preparation, coordination and management of customer claims

Problem-solving-oriented work with a high level of technical understanding and customer orientation

Systematic root cause analysis and definition of sustainable corrective measures and documentation of the results

Processing of warranties incl. statement to the customer

Creating technical customer reports and its analysis

Ensures compliance with all legal and other guidelines applicable in the company

Drive Project Management of MRO and Services

Handles technical queries from Customers

Close cooperation with Field Service and Shopfloor Service

Support Order Management team on technical Spare Part RFQ’s
